Output 37b160f891830f00f461b79053a6e17e05cb9cdc583044ecfd81ae5dc19378bd:1

value
1500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a22cbdf4c5e094dc8f1753051cb573013b7ca3 OP_EQUAL
address
3HFF5FnXrZXYJaHvjSeuHDkydbHcyPZDRx
transaction
37b160f891830f00f461b79053a6e17e05cb9cdc583044ecfd81ae5dc19378bd